“Some quotes are too good to ignore, including the following one by my friend Mike Durante, founder of Western Reserve Hedge Fund in Dallas and a former Federal Reserve bank examiner.*

‘. . . some of us . . . have consistently referred to the hypocrisy of President Obamaโ€™s so-termed โ€˜Comprehensive Financial Reformโ€™ so we never ever ever never ever never again experience a housing crisis again which EXCLUDES HUD, Fannie Mae, Freddie Mac, GMAC, Car Dealers, Chrysler Credit and R/E attorneys. Instead we are to believe we need 3,000 pages that attack credit card transaction fees, derivatives trading, profits and banker compensation as a means to promote no future housing frivolity.’” Read more.
